Sign In
Get Started →
What are David Marwick’s favorite books?

David Marwick

Staff Software Engineer at Twitter
United States
SummaryAI Assisted Badge

David Marwick is a seasoned software engineering professional known for his expertise in microservice architecture, metadata management, data discovery, and data pipelines. With a demonstrated track record of independent contribution, he excels as a data-driven problem solver and clear communicator.

David is detail-oriented, a rapid learner, and adept at working within agile environments. His core technologies include Scala, Java, SQL, MySQL, Vertica, and Linux. David brings with him a wealth of domain knowledge, particularly in areas related to job scheduling, ETL, data warehousing, data integration, data processing, and structured data.

David Marwick's educational background includes studies at Kimball University and earning a Bachelor of Arts in Computer Science from Oberlin College. Currently, he serves as a Staff Software Engineer at Twitter, where he leverages his skills and leadership qualities to drive impactful projects forward.

This public profile is provided courtesy of Clay. All information found here is in the public domain.